Justice Agyemang Takes Leave of The Gambia

thepoint.gm - After four years of excellent service in The Gambia as a High Court Judge under the Commonwealth Assistance Scheme, Justice Mabel Maame Agyemang has taken leave of The Gambia. A farewell ceremony was organised for her yesterday at the Chief Justice’s Chambers, Law Courts Banjul.
